云服务器数据库是指部署在云服务器上的数据库系统。它利用云计算的弹性扩展能力,提供高可用性、高可靠性和高性能的数据存储和处理服务。云服务器数据库通常支持多种数据库类型,如关系型数据库(如MySQL、PostgreSQL)、NoSQL数据库(如MongoDB、Redis)等。
以下是一个在云服务器上配置MySQL数据库的基本步骤:
在云平台上创建一台云服务器实例,选择合适的操作系统(如Ubuntu、CentOS)。
通过SSH连接到云服务器,安装MySQL数据库:
# 对于Ubuntu
sudo apt update
sudo apt install mysql-server
# 对于CentOS
sudo yum update
sudo yum install mysql-server
启动并初始化MySQL服务:
sudo systemctl start mysql
sudo mysql_secure_installation
按照提示设置root用户的密码和其他安全选项。
打开MySQL默认端口(通常是3306):
# 对于Ubuntu
sudo ufw allow 3306/tcp
# 对于CentOS
sudo firewall-cmd --permanent --add-port=3306/tcp
sudo firewall-cmd --reload
使用MySQL客户端连接到数据库:
mysql -u root -p
输入之前设置的root密码,成功连接后即可开始使用MySQL数据库。
原因:可能是配置文件错误、端口被占用或权限问题。
解决方法:
/var/log/mysql/error.log
,查看具体错误信息。/etc/mysql/my.cnf
或/etc/my.cnf
),确保配置正确。原因:可能是防火墙未开放端口、MySQL服务未启动或连接参数错误。
解决方法:
sudo systemctl status mysql
。通过以上步骤和解决方法,您可以在云服务器上成功配置和使用数据库。
领取专属 10元无门槛券
手把手带您无忧上云